Zhu Q, Wada H, Ueda Y, Onuki K, Miyakawa M, Sato S, Kameda Y, Matsumoto F, Inoshita A, Nakano H, Tanigawa T. Association between habitual snoring and vigilant attention in elementary school children. Sleep Med 2024; 118:9-15. Abstract
OBJECTIVES Vigilant attention (VA) is a fundamental neurocognitive function. However, the association between habitual snoring (HS) and VA in community-based children remains unclear. Therefore, this study aimed to elucidate the association. METHODS The study included 2014 children from grades 1-6 across six elementary schools. Snoring frequency was evaluated using a questionnaire administered to parents. VA was assessed using a brief 3-min psychomotor vigilance test (PVT-B). Generalized linear models and multivariate logistic regression analysis were utilized to examine the association between snoring frequency and PVT-B performance. Impaired PVT-B performance was defined as the worst quartile of PVT-B metrics. RESULTS The PVT-B performance significantly improved with advancing school grade level (p trend < 0.0001). A significant negative correlation was observed between snoring frequency and PVT-B performance. Particularly, in grade 1, HS was associated with a higher risk of impaired PVT-B performance, including response speed (mean reciprocal reaction time) (adjusted odds ratio [aOR] 2.56, 95% confidence interval [CI]: 1.20-5.50), more slowest 10% RT (aOR 3.28, 95% CI: 1.51-6.88), and more lapse500 (number of lapse of reaction time ≥ 500 ms) (aOR 3.18, 95% CI: 1.45-6.80) compared to children without snoring. CONCLUSIONS Our findings show that VA rapidly improves throughout elementary school. Additionally, younger children with HS are at risk of VA deficits, emphasizing the importance of early intervention for HS.

Nakamura M, Anzai T, Ishimizu E, Kubo S, Inoshita A, Takata Y, Hayashi T, Matsumoto F. Clinical Approach to Dental Root Canal Filler-Induced Maxillary Sinus Fungal Mass Using Transnasal Endoscopy. J Craniofac Surg 2024:00001665-990000000-01463. Abstract
Accidentally extruded root canal filler within the sinuses may induce maxillary sinusitis with fungal mass. The authors describe 2 cases of gutta-percha-induced fungal masses in the left maxillary sinus of 2 women. The lesions were evaluated preoperatively using both computed tomography and magnetic resonance imaging, providing comprehensive insights into the condition. In one patient, the lesion was located such that it could be resected through the middle meatal antrostomy alone. However, the second patient presented with an anteroinferiorly situated lesion that necessitated not only a transnasal approach but also an endoscopic modified medial maxillectomy. Both patients recovered uneventfully after surgery. This case series is the first published report of 2 cases of gutta-percha-induced maxillary sinus fungal masses, with their imaging findings, successfully treated through different routes through transnasal endoscopic surgery. These reports highlight the need for a collaborative approach between dental practitioners and otolaryngologists. In addition to the patient's wishes, surgical interventions must consider the unique characteristics of each case and the potential for collaboration across different medical specialties.

Abstract
INTRODUCTION Intravascular papillary endothelial hyperplasia (IPEH) predominantly occurs in the subcutaneous and dermal regions and rarely originates from the sinonasal mucosa. CASE PRESENTATION We report on the case of a 58-year-old male patient who presented with progressive bilateral nasal obstruction, left-sided epiphora, and intermittent epistaxis. Computed tomography revealed a soft tissue opacity in the left maxillary sinus with intersinusoidal nasal wall demineralization, extending into the surrounding ethmoid cells and the right nasal cavity through a contralateral deviation of the nasal septum. Contrast-enhanced T1-weighted magnetic resonance imaging further confirmed these findings. The IPEH originating from the maxillary sinus extended into the contralateral nasal cavity, and it was successfully removed using an endoscopic endonasal approach, avoiding overly aggressive treatment. CONCLUSION This case report highlights the diagnostic challenges of IPEH in the sinonasal region and the importance of considering IPEH as a differential diagnosis in patients presenting with nasal obstruction, epiphora, and intermittent epistaxis.

Abstract
Lobular capillary hemangiomas (LCH), which usually originate in the skin and mucous membranes of the oral cavity, are uncommon from the posterior portion of the inferior turbinate. Although the exact cause of LCH in the nasal cavity has not been elucidated, trauma, caused by factors such as intranasal packing and habitual nose-picking, has been reported as one of the causes. In addition, 2 cases of LCH caused by submucosal resection with powered instrumentation to the inferior turbinate have been reported, suggesting that various types of traumas to the nasal mucosa can cause LCH. The authors report the first case of LCH formation in the posterior portion of the inferior turbinate after cauterization with silver nitrate.

Abstract
PURPOSE Allergic rhinitis (AR) is associated with obstructive sleep apnea (OSA) and nasal obstruction causes decreased adherence to continuous positive airway pressure (CPAP). The purpose is to evaluate the effects of antiallergic agents on CPAP adherence and sleep quality. METHODS A longitudinal study was made of patients who use CPAP for OSA and treated with antiallergy agents for spring pollinosis. We compared the Pittsburgh Sleep Quality Index (PSQI), Epworth Sleepiness Scale (ESS), nasal symptoms scores (NSS), and data from CPAP before and after treatment. Then, we classified the subjects into two groups based on the baseline PSQI score: one group without a decreased sleep quality (PSQI < 6) and the other group with decreased sleep quality (PSQI ≥ 6). RESULTS Of 28 subjects enrolled, 13 had good sleep quality and 15 had poor sleep quality. PSQI showed significant improvements after medication (p = 0.046). ESS showed no significant differences after AR medication (p = 0.565). Significant improvement was observed after the prescription of antiallergy agents in all items of NSS (sneezing, p < 0.05; rhinorrhea, p < 0.01; nasal obstruction, p < 0.01; QOL, p < 0.01). The percentage of days with CPAP use more than 4 h increased significantly after the administration of rhinitis medication (p = 0.022). In the intragroup comparisons of PSQI ≥ 6 group, PSQI decreased significantly (p < 0.05). For the NSS in intragroup comparisons of PSQI ≥ 6 group, all parameters showed significant improvement (sneezing, p = 0.016; rhinorrhea, p = 0.005; nasal obstruction, p < 0.005; QOL, p < 0.005). CONCLUSION The use of antiallergy agents can improve CPAP adherence and sleep quality in patients with OSA on CPAP.

Abstract
We report a 63-year-old female patient with progressive supranuclear palsy (PSP). She presented predominant postural instability and "saccadic ping-pong gaze" (SPPG). She had unprovoked falls recurrently within a year from the onset of gait disturbance. She tended to fall backward with eye closure but had no freezing of gait on examination. She showed no signs of nuchal dystonia, limb tremor, rigidity, spasticity, or ataxia. The dopaminergic response was negative. On the initial examination, her vertical eye movements were normal, but frequent macro square wave jerks and SPPG were observed. SPPG consisted of short-cycle, horizontal conjugate irregular pendular oscillations of the eye position from the midpoint with superimposed small saccades. SPPG was observed usually in the dark, not in the daylight, and with eye closure by using electrooculogram and infrared charge-coupled device imaging. One and a half years after the first examination, she was diagnosed as probable PSP with vertical supranuclear gaze palsy. SPPG was first described in patients who are unconscious by Johkura in 1998 as a "saccadic" variant of "ping-pong gaze (PPG)." PPG, short-cycle periodic alternating gaze, has been described in comatose patients since 1967. On the other hand, abnormal eye movement, which looks the same as SPPG in coma, has been described in conscious patients with PSP or spinocerebellar degeneration (SCD) in Japanese literature since 1975. However, it has been called "transient alternating saccades (TAS)." Nowadays, we believe it is more appropriate to call this abnormal eye movement "SPPG" instead of TAS. Here, we propose that PSP, a neuro-degenerative disease, should be added as one of the etiologies of SPPG. We discuss the differences between PPG/SPPG in coma and SPPG in PSP and the possible pathophysiological mechanism of SPPG in relation to cerebellar oculomotor dysfunctions.

Abstract
BACKGROUND In recent years, a relatively high prevalence of obstructive sleep apnea (OSA) in patients following radiotherapy (RT) for head and neck cancer (HNC) has been reported; however, little is known regarding the impact of RT on sleep disorders and the underlying mechanisms. This aim of this study was to elucidate the pathogenesis of OSA by comparing the clinical and sleep test parameters and magnetic resonance imaging (MRI) findings before and after HNC treatment with radiation. METHODS This prospective study included patients scheduled for RT with or without chemotherapy or bioradiotherapy for HNC. Patients diagnosed with HNC between May 2017 and August 2020 were consecutively recruited. The results of the sleep tests were analyzed both before and after treatment. The clinical characteristics of the patients and cephalometric and MRI parameters were also measured. RESULTS First, a total of 32 patients (64.8±11.8 years old; BMI, 22.7±3.6 kg/m2) underwent pre-treatment sleep tests. The prevalence of OSA [apnea hypopnea index (AHI) ≥5] in these patients was 81.3% (26 patients) before treatment, and the mean AHI was 20.8±19.0 events/hr. Next, 21 patients performed a sleep test both before and after treatment. Regarding subjective symptoms, there were no significant differences in the Epworth Sleepiness Scale (ESS) (P=0.142) or Pittsburgh Sleep Quality Index (PSQI) (P=0.935) after treatment; however, the BMI and neck circumference significantly decreased after treatment (P<0.0001 and P=0.0001, respectively). The incidence of OSA in these patients was 81.0% (17 patients) before treatment and 85.7% (19 patients) after treatment (P=1.0). Overall, the AHI was not significantly different, changing only from 14.5 to 14.9 after treatment (P=0.147). The MRI parameters showed that the retroglossal pharyngeal area increased significantly after treatment (P=0.007). CONCLUSIONS This study found that the prevalence of OSA before and after RT for HNC was higher than that in the normal population, despite a significant decrease in BMI and increase in the retroglossal pharyngeal area after treatment. We suggest that physicians who manage patients with HNC should consider the occurrence of OSA before and after treatment.

Abstract
Creutzfeldt-Jakob disease is a fatal transmissible prion disease of the central nervous system. Dizziness as an initial manifestation of Creutzfeldt-Jakob disease is rare. However, patients with Creutzfeldt-Jakob disease and dizziness may initially visit the otolaryngology department, but this is uncommon. We report the case of a 56-year-old woman with Creutzfeldt-Jakob disease who initially presented with dizziness as an emergency patient to the otolaryngology department. Primary position upbeat nystagmus was identified using a charge-coupled device camera with infrared illumination. Electronystagmography revealed impaired smooth pursuit and diminished optokinetic nystagmus. Based on these findings, we immediately suspected an intracranial cause of dizziness and reached a presumptive diagnosis of sporadic Creutzfeldt-Jakob disease, thus preventing severe transmission. This case emphasizes that Creutzfeldt-Jakob disease should be included as a differential diagnosis for patients with dizziness and abnormal eye movements, such as primary position upbeat nystagmus, which might be caused by intracranial disease.

Abstract
Concurrent chemoradiotherapy (CCRT) is one of the most promising treatments for advanced head and neck cancer (HNC). On the other hand, CCRT may induce severe edema in laryngo-pharyngeal structures in association with radiation. This is a report of a 66-year-old man with severe obstructive sleep apnea (OSA) associated with edema in laryngo-hypopharynx after CCRT for advanced laryngeal and hypopharyngeal cancer. Tracheostomy was avoided and OSA was controlled by continuous positive airway pressure (CPAP). Subjective symptoms of sleepiness were improved. Though laryngeal edema appeared during the course of CCRT in this case, OSA was not evaluated until snoring had been pointed out and he complained of sleepiness. CCRT for laryngeal and hypopharyngeal cancer have a risk of occurrence of OSA due to irreversible mucous edema in the upper airway. Patients for whom CCRT is planned should be informed about the occurrence of OSA before the treatment because symptoms associated with OSA can negatively impact not only the daytime quality of life but also increase the risk of cardiovascular events. The OSA treatment for post CCRT would be expected to have a positive impact on not only cardiovascular and metabolic systems but also on the cancer treatment survival rate.

Abstract
Background Childhood obstructive sleep apnea (OSA) has important implications for growth, learning, behavior, cognition and cardiovascular health as well as snoring and OSA in adulthood. In this study, we elucidated the sex differences in polysomnographic (PSG) findings and pharyngeal radiographic data in pediatric OSA patients. Methods Sixty three children (age between 3 and 15 years old) with OSA [defined as apnea-hypopnea index (AHI) ≥1/h by polysomnography] were enrolled. Lateral neck radiographs were obtained from the patients. All subjects were separated by age: pre-adolescent group (3-8 years old) and adolescent group (9-15 years old). Results Overall, 45 patients in the pre-adolescent group (33 boys and 12 girls) and 18 patients in the adolescent group (10 boys and 8 girls) were enrolled, and sex differences were compared in each group. We found sex differences in craniofacial features and severity of OSA in the adolescent group, in which girls with OSA had more upper airway space, in addition to lower AHI, lower 3% oxygen desaturation index (ODI), higher minimum SO2 and better sleep efficiency than the boys. Conclusions The present study found revealed sex differences in pediatric OSA patients in the adolescent group. Girls in the adolescent group had more upper airway space in addition to lower AHI, lower 3% ODI, higher minimum SO2 and better sleep efficiency than boys.

Abstract
Background The greater epithelial ridge (GER) is a developmental structure in the maturation of the organ of Corti. Situated near the inner hair cells of neonatal mice, the GER undergoes a wave of apoptosis after postnatal day 8 (P8). We evaluated the GER from P8 to P12 in transgenic mice that carry the R75W + mutation, a dominant-negative mutation of human gap junction protein, beta 2, 26 kDa (GJB2) (also known as connexin 26 or CX26). Cx26 facilitate intercellular communication within the mammalian auditory organ. Results In both non-transgenic (non-Tg) and R75W + mice, some GER cells exhibited apoptotic characteristics at P8. In the GER of non-Tg mice, both the total number of cells and the number of apoptotic cells decreased from P8 to P12. In contrast, apoptotic cells were still clearly evident in the GER of R75W + mice at P12. In R75W + mice, therefore, apoptosis in the GER persisted until a later stage of cochlear development. In addition, the GER of R75W + mice exhibited morphological signs of retention, which may have resulted from diminished levels of apoptosis and/or promotion of cell proliferation during embryogenesis and early postnatal stages of development. Conclusions Here we demonstrate that Cx26 dysfunction is associated with delayed apoptosis of GER cells and GER retention. This is the first demonstration that Cx26 may regulate cell proliferation and apoptosis during development of the cochlea.

Abstract
PURPOSE Obstructive sleep apnea (OSA) is complicated with heart failure (HF); however, the reason for this is not well understood. Craniofacial anatomic risk factors may contribute to OSA pathogenesis in HF patients. However, there are no data about cephalometric findings among OSA patients with HF. METHODS Consecutive patients with HF and OSA (defined as total apnea-hypopnea index (AHI) ≥15/h) were enrolled. As controls, OSA patients without HF but matching the test group in age, BMI, and obstructive AHI were also enrolled. RESULTS Overall, 17 OSA patients with HF and 34 OSA patients without HF were compared. There are no significant differences in the characteristics or polysomnographic parameters between 2 groups. In the cephalometric findings, compared with patients without HF, patients with HF showed a significantly greater angle between the line SN to point "A" (SNA) and a longer inferior airway space and greater airway area. However, the tongue area of patients with HF was more than those without HF. CONCLUSIONS The craniofacial structures of OSA patients with HF were different from those without HF. OSA patients with HF had an upper airway anatomy that is more likely to collapse when sleeping while recumbent, despite having a larger airway space.

Abstract
Introduction Segmental duplications (low-copy repeats) are the recently duplicated genomic segments in the human genome that display nearly identical (> 90%) sequences and account for about 5% of euchromatic regions. In germline, duplicated segments mediate nonallelic homologous recombination and thus cause both non-disease-causing copy-number variants and genomic disorders. To what extent duplicated segments play a role in somatic DNA rearrangements in cancer remains elusive. Duplicated segments often cluster and form genomic blocks enriched with both direct and inverted repeats (complex genomic regions). Such complex regions could be fragile and play a mechanistic role in the amplification of the ERBB2 gene in breast tumors, because repeated sequences are known to initiate gene amplification in model systems. Methods We conducted polymerase chain reaction (PCR)-based assays for primary breast tumors and analyzed publically available array-comparative genomic hybridization data to map a common copy-number breakpoint in ERBB2-amplified primary breast tumors. We further used molecular, bioinformatics, and population-genetics approaches to define duplication contents, structural variants, and haplotypes within the common breakpoint. Results We found a large (> 300-kb) block of duplicated segments that was colocalized with a common-copy number breakpoint for ERBB2 amplification. The breakpoint that potentially initiated ERBB2 amplification localized in a region 1.5 megabases (Mb) on the telomeric side of ERBB2. The region is very complex, with extensive duplications of KRTAP genes, structural variants, and, as a result, a paucity of single-nucleotide polymorphism (SNP) markers. Duplicated segments are varied in size and degree of sequence homology, indicating that duplications have occurred recurrently during genome evolution. Conclusions Amplification of the ERBB2 gene in breast tumors is potentially initiated by a complex region that has unusual genomic features and thus requires rigorous, labor-intensive investigation. The haplotypes we provide could be useful to identify the potential association between the complex region and ERBB2 amplification.

Abstract
INTRODUCTION A ganglioneuroma is a benign neoplasm arising from neural crest cells of the sympathetic nerve fibers and is most commonly seen in the posterior mediastinum or retroperitoneum. Although very uncommon, ganglioneuromas must be included in the differential diagnosis of neck masses. In young adult women, neck incisions made for excision of these benign tumors should be avoided whenever possible. CASE PRESENTATION We herein describe the case of a 19-year-old Japanese woman with a ganglioneuroma. The tumor was found in the parapharyngeal space, an unusual location. A fine-needle aspiration biopsy was performed but was considered inadequate to make a definitive diagnosis, so the asymptomatic lesion was surgically excised using a Weerda laryngoscope. The lesion measured 4 × 3 cm in size and was encapsulated. A pathological analysis showed the presence of two distinct cell types, ganglion cells and Schwann cells, embedded in a loose myxoid stroma. The final diagnosis was a ganglioneuroma. CONCLUSION A complete excision was made possible by using a transoral approach with a novel use of the Weerda laryngoscope. Although its applicability to specific cases depends on the location, size and nature of the tumor, we believe that the Weerda laryngoscope will continue to be useful for performing transoral surgery for cervical tumors.

Abstract
PURPOSE Chronic rhinosinusitis (CRS) is known to be a polymicrobial infection involving both aerobes and Gram-positive and Gram-negative anaerobes. Accurate bacterial evaluation by adequate culture methods can justify subsequent antimicrobial strategies. METHODS Two specimens were obtained from each of 10 patients undergoing catheter-based Balloon Sinuplasty™, one from the middle meatus (endoscopic approach) and the other from the sinus (catheter-based approach). RESULTS The bacterial culture from the middle meatus was positive in 9 of 10 patients, including 6 different aerobes without anaerobes. The bacterial culture of aspirates from the sinuses were positive in 8 out of 10 patients, with 4 different aerobic bacteria and 4 different anaerobic bacteria. Anaerobes were isolated in 0% of middle meatus samples, which was significantly lower than the 62.5% (5/8) detected in the sinus samples. CONCLUSIONS Bacterial culture of sinus aspirates using a catheter-based technique improves the recovery of bacterial pathogens from CRS patients.

Abstract
We present herein the imaging and pathological features of a 28-year-old male with a sinonasal hemangiopericytoma-like tumor occupying the left nasal meatus. At the initial visit, a nasal polyp was suspected, but, as the patient was bleeding readily, an angiomatoid lesion was also regarded as a possible diagnosis. Based on a thorough histopathological analysis, a sinonasal hemangiopericytoma-like tumor was diagnosed. Hematoxylin and eosin staining also showed a mild degree of nuclear pleomorphism and a slight increase in mitotic activity, and immunohistochemical studies using anti-CD34, MIB-1, and Vimentin antibodies were useful for distinguishing the hemangiopericytoma-like tumor from true hemangiopericytoma and a solitary fibrous tumor.

Abstract
OBJECTIVES Co-mobidity of asthma is known to result in a poor prognosis of post-endoscopic sinus surgery (post-ESS). Bacterial infection may play a key role in recurrent pathophysiology of sinusitis in post-ESS. METHODS Forty-two patients with CRS associated with asthma undergoing ESS were enrolled. Bacterial culture was performed from the sinus cavity at the time of acute infectious episodes. Recurrence of sinonasal disease was analyzed in terms of steroid responsiveness and peak expiratory flow (PEF). RESULTS Totally 75 aspirates were obtained during post-ESS; 2 repeat aspirates from 10 patients, 3 from 5 patients, and 4 from 2 patients. Only 6 specimens (8.0%) obtained from 5 patients (11.9%) showed no growth whereas 83 isolates were recovered from 69 specimens. Sixteen patients had at least one episode of a significant decline of PEF. All except one patient complained of symptoms and signs of upper respiratory infections prior to a depression of PEF. Positive culture was obtained in 10 out of 11 patients examined at the time of acute exacerbation of CRS. CONCLUSION Bacterial infection may play a critical role of recurrent polyps and refractory symptoms during post-ESS follow-up. Moreover, worsening of sinusitis accompanies asthma exacerbation.

Abstract
The increased risk of cardiovascular morbidity and mortality among patients with sleep-disordered breathing (SDB) has been linked to arterial hypertension and insulin resistance. However, an effective antihypertensive agent for patients with SDB has not been identified. We investigated the effect of the angiotensin II subtype 1 receptor blocker olmesartan in hypertensive patients with SDB. This prospective, one-arm pilot study included 25 male patients with untreated SDB (mean age, 52.7 ± 11.4 years). We measured blood pressure, oxygen desaturation index (ODI), cardiac function using echocardiography, and insulin resistance using the homeostasis model assessment (HOMA) before and after 12 weeks of olmesartan therapy (mean dose, 17.6 ± 4.4 mg/day). Olmesartan significantly decreased systolic blood pressure (151.4 ± 8.0 vs. 134.0 ± 7.4 mmHg; P < 0.001), diastolic blood pressure (93.4 ± 7.1 vs. 83.9 ± 6.3 mmHg; P < 0.001), and HOMA index (3.7 ± 2.9 vs. 2.8 ± 1.9; P = 0.012). Furthermore, left ventricular ejection fraction significantly increased at 12 weeks (68.1 ± 5.1 vs. 71.6 ± 5.4%; P = 0.009). However, body mass index (BMI) and degree of SDB did not change (BMI, 26.6 ± 4.0 vs. 26.6 ± 4.2 kg/m2, P = 0.129; 3% ODI, 29.5 ± 23.1 vs. 28.2 ± 21.0 events/h, P = 0.394). Olmesartan significantly reduced blood pressure and insulin resistance in hypertensive patients with SDB without changing BMI or SDB severity.

Abstract
OBJECTIVES The link between nasal and bronchial disease has been studied extensively for chronic rhinosinusitis and asthma. The concept of "united airway allergy" has become widely accepted in the past decade. We evaluated the relationship between the upper and lower airways during follow-up after endoscopic sinus surgery by monitoring sinonasal and pulmonary functions. METHODS Thirty-nine subjects with chronic rhinosinusitis associated with bronchial asthma were entered in this study. A self smell test using stick-type odorant materials was carried out daily to evaluate postoperative recurrence of sinonasal disease. Each patient was assessed for peak expiratory flow (PEF) 3 times daily. RESULTS The average (+/- SD) scores of initial symptoms were 8.3 +/- 2.2, which was significantly decreased to 1.5 +/- 1.4 by 3 months after operation. During postoperative follow-up, 25 of 39 patients showed no decrease in PEF, whereas the other 14 patients had at least 1 episode of a significant decline in PEF. In the postoperative course, with respect to the self smell test, 24 patients showed no aggravation of smell, but 15 patients had episode(s) of decreased olfaction. Twelve patients demonstrated worsening on the smell test concomitant with a decreased PEF. A discrepancy between olfactory acuity and pulmonary function was recognized in 5 patients. There were 22 patients with a good prognosis of parameters of both the upper and lower airways. CONCLUSIONS Daily monitoring of both upper and lower respiratory tract functions clearly revealed dual relationships, indicating that worsening of sinusitis accompanies asthma exacerbation. Appropriate measures of the upper and lower airways following endoscopic sinus surgery can be used to predict patient outcome.

Abstract
CONCLUSION GJB2 mutations are responsible not only for deafness but also for the occurrence of vestibular dysfunction. However, vestibular dysfunction tends to be unilateral and less severe in comparison with that of bilateral deafness. OBJECTIVES The correlation between the cochlear and vestibular end-organs suggests that some children with congenital deafness may have vestibular impairments. On the other hand, GJB2 gene mutations are the most common cause of nonsyndromic deafness. The vestibular function of patients with congenital deafness (CD), which is related to GJB2 gene mutation, remains to be elucidated. The purpose of this study was to analyze the relationship between GJB2 gene mutation and vestibular dysfunction in adults with CD. METHODS A total of 31 subjects, including 10 healthy volunteers and 21 patients with CD, were enrolled in the study. A hearing test and genetic analysis were performed. The vestibular evoked myogenic potentials (VEMPs) were measured and a caloric test was performed to assess the vestibular function. The percentage of vestibular dysfunction was then statistically analyzed. RESULTS The hearing level of all CD patients demonstrated a severe to profound impairment. In seven CD patients, their hearing impairment was related to GJB2 mutation. Five of the seven patients with CD related to GJB2 mutation demonstrated abnormalities in one or both of the two tests. The percentage of vestibular dysfunction of the patients with CD related to GJB2 mutation was statistically higher than in patients with CD unrelated to GJB2 mutation and in healthy controls.

Abstract
AIM Changes in plasma immunoreactive insulin (IRI) and connecting-peptide immunoreactivity (CPR) concentrations during hemodialysis (HD) were evaluated in diabetic HD patients with 3 different high-flux membranes. The removal properties of the membranes were compared. METHOD In this prospective controlled study, 15 stable diabetic patients on HD were randomly selected for 6 HD sessions with 3 different membranes: polysulfone (PS), cellulose triacetate (CTA), and polymethylmethacrylate (PMMA). Blood samples were obtained from the blood tubing at the arterial (A) site at the beginning and end of the sixth HD session. At 60 minutes after dialysis initiation, blood samples were obtained from both the A and venous (V) sites of the dialyzer to investigate the clearance and removal properties of the membranes. RESULTS The plasma IRI and CPR levels decreased significantly at each time point with all 3 membranes. IRI clearance with the PS membrane was significantly higher than that with the CTA and PMMA membranes. No difference was observed in the IRI reduction rate between the 3 membranes. CPR clearance and reduction rate with the PMMA membrane were lower than with the PS and CTA membranes. No significant difference was observed in serum creatinine clearance and reduction rates between the 3 membranes; however, serum urea nitrogen clearance was significantly lower with the PMMA membrane compared with the PS and CTA membranes. A significantly high beta2-microglobulin clearance and reduction rate was achieved in the order PS > CTA > PMMA. CONCLUSION Plasma IRI and CPR are cleared by HD; their clearance rates differ with the dialyzer membranes. Plasma IRI clearance with the PS membrane is higher than that with the CTA and PMMA membranes.

Abstract
Hereditary hearing loss is one of the most prevalent inherited human birth defects, affecting one in 2000. A strikingly high proportion (50%) of congenital bilateral nonsyndromic sensorineural deafness cases have been linked to mutations in the GJB2 coding for the connexin26. It has been hypothesized that gap junctions in the cochlea, especially connexin26, provide an intercellular passage by which K(+) are transported to maintain high levels of the endocochlear potential essential for sensory hair cell excitation. We previously reported the generation of a mouse model carrying human connexin26 with R75W mutation (R75W+ mice). The present study attempted to evaluate postnatal development of the organ of Corti in the R75W+ mice. R75W+ mice have never shown auditory brainstem response waveforms throughout postnatal development, indicating the disturbance of auditory organ development. Histological observations at postnatal days (P) 5-14 were characterized by i) absence of tunnel of Corti, Nuel's space, or spaces surrounding the outer hair cells, ii) significantly small numbers of microtubules in inner pillar cells, iii) shortening of height of the organ of Corti, and iv) increase of the cross-sectional area of the cells of the organ of Corti. Thus, morphological observations confirmed that a dominant-negative Gjb2 mutation showed incomplete development of the cochlear supporting cells. On the other hand, the development of the sensory hair cells, at least from P5 to P12, was not affected. The present study suggests that Gjb2 is indispensable in the postnatal development of the organ of Corti and normal hearing.

Abstract
There are a number of genetic diseases that affect the cochlea early in life, which require normal gene transfer in the early developmental stage to prevent deafness. The delivery of adenovirus (AdV) and adeno-associated virus (AAV) was investigated to elucidate the efficiency and cellular specificity of transgene expression in the neonatal mouse cochlea. The extent of AdV transfection is comparable to that obtained with adult mice. AAV-directed gene transfer after injection into the scala media through a cochleostomy showed transgene expression in the supporting cells, inner hair cells (IHCs), and lateral wall with resulting hearing loss. On the other hand, gene expression was observed in Deiters cells, IHCs, and lateral wall without hearing loss after the application of AAV into the scala tympani through the round window. These findings indicate that injection of AAV into the scala tympani of the neonatal mouse cochlea therefore has the potential to efficiently and noninvasively introduce transgenes to the cochlear supporting cells, and this modality is thus considered to be a promising strategy to prevent hereditary prelingual deafness.

Abstract
The pathogenesis of focal glomerular sclerosis (FGS) is poorly understood. Macrophage migration inhibitory factor (MIF) is a potent pro-inflammatory cytokine released from T cells and macrophages, and is a key molecule in inflammation. To examine further the possible role of MIF in FGS, we measured MIF levels in the urine. The purpose of the present study was to evaluate the involvement of MIF in FGS. Urine samples were obtained from 20 FGS patients. The disease controls included 40 patients with minimal-change nephrotic syndrome (MCNS) and membranous nephropathy (MN). A group of healthy subjects also served as controls. Biopsies were performed in all patients prior to entry to the study. The samples were assayed for MIF protein by a sandwich enzyme-linked immunosorbent assay (ELISA). The levels of MIF in the urine of FGS patients were significantly higher than those of the normal controls and patients with MCNS and MN. In contrast, the levels of urinary MIF (uMIF) in patients with MCNS and MN did not differ significantly from normal values. In the present study, attention also focused on the relationship between uMIF levels and pathological features. Among the patients with FGS, uMIF levels were significantly correlated with the grade of mesangial matrix increase and that of interstitial fibrosis. There was also a significant correlation between uMIF levels and the number of both intraglomerular and interstitial macrophages. Although the underlying mechanisms remain to be determined, our study presents evidence that urinary excretion of MIF is increased in FGS patients with active renal lesions.
